Description

This much improved extended link detached family home offers spacious accommodation throughout which in brief comprises entrance hall with staircase to the first floor, spacious lounge with a feature stone fire place with incorporated coal effect electric convector fire and wooden flooring. The extended family/dining kitchen has a range of beechwood style units with integrated electric hob, electric oven and stainless steel canopy extractor hood. Further integrated appliances include a under counter refrigerator and dishwasher. The extended family area has PVCu double glazed French doors leading onto the rear garden and there is wooden flooring throughout the kitchen, dining and family room areas. The understairs cupboard provides storage and also houses the mains gas boiler.

The first floor landing has access to loft via a pull down ladder and also leads to the three bedrooms with a built in double cupboard located in the master bedroom which also houses the water cylinder. There are also a range of fitted wardrobes and drawer units located in the second bedroom. The family bathroom has a modern white coloured suite comprising a corner bath, pedestal hand wash basin and a low level W.C. There is also a separate shower cubicle with incorporated shower unit. The property also benefits from gas central heating and PVCu double glazing.

The frontage has been block paved providing offroad parking for vehicles and leads to the garage which is located to the side of the property. The well maintained rear garden is enclosed by panelled fencing and laid mainly to lawn with established shrub borders. There is a block paved patio and path to the side elevation leading to a gate providing access to the front elevation. The garage has power, lighting and two metal up and over doors to both the front and rear elevations.
